Industrial high pressure processes open the door to many reactions that are not possible under 'normal' conditions. These are to be found
in such different areas as polymerization, catalytic reactions, separations, oil and gas recovery, food processing, biocatalysis and more.
The most famous high pressure process is the so-called Haber-Bosch process used for fertilizers and which was awarded a Nobel prize.

Following an introduction on historical development, the current state, and future trends, this timely and comprehensive publication goes on to describe different industrial processes, including methanol and other catalytic syntheses, polymerization and renewable energy processes, before covering safety and equipment issues.

With its excellent choice of industrial contributions, this handbook offers high quality information not found elsewhere, making it invaluable
reading for a broad and interdisciplinary audience.
